Black Caps bowler Neil Wagner feels prepared to attack the English when they meet in the first cricket test in Mount Maunganui on Thursday
19 November 2019
Wagner's vying with Trent Boult, Tim Southee, Matt Henry and Lockie Ferguson for what are expected to be three pace spots.
The Northern Districts quick has taken 12 wickets in the first three Plunket Shield matches.
Wagner says getting the strength and conditioning and mental side of things right over the winter have been beneficial.
